Meet Paul

Born and raised in south central Ohio, Paul grew up on a 210 acre cattle/crop farm. He graduated from Edward Lee McClain high school, earned a Bachelor of Science in Technology and Industrial Arts Management from Berea College in Berea, Kentucky, and earned a Master of Science in Technology from Purdue University in West Lafayette, Indiana. Over the past 15 years, he has worked as an application engineer in the manufacturing sector, an Instructor/Professor of Practice in higher education, and Director of a manufacturing makerspace with over 100 employees. He currently resides in Warren County where he maintains a small hobby farm with his wife and kids. He is a proud father of two teenagers and proud husband of an elementary school teacher.
